Prologue Neha's POV He held me tight by my waist against the wall preventing me from escaping. His grip was so tight I was sure it would leave a bruise. "Haven't I told you how ugly you look, how ungraceful you are and how wretched you are?" He asked me in a calm voice that sent shivers down my spine. He continued before I could even utter a word. "I will never love you, I can't even like you. You are such a disgrace to me that I will only HATE you" He shouted at my face and left me broken. This time his words hit me hard emotionally and physically.I fell to the ground sobbing my heart out hoping someone out there would reduce the pain in my heart. But I should have known that I'm alone, have always been so.
